

118: Whole Person Management, with Malvika Jethmalani
Today's workplace demands whole-person management: Employees no longer check their emotions and personal challenges at the door.
Guest Malvika Jethmalani, three-time CHRO and co-founder of Atvis Group, talks about the three-step employee listening strategy that forms the foundation of compassionate leadership: listening to understand pain points, analyzing feedback implications, and taking meaningful action.
She shares why many organizations create survey fatigue and erode trust by collecting data without follow-through, and offers practical insights on balancing quantitative methods like engagement surveys with qualitative approaches such as focus groups, as drivers of better business outcomes.
We discuss psychological safety as a business imperative, immersion instead of traditional onboarding, and how politically charged topics like return-to-office policies and DEI initiatives require thoughtful leadership approaches that go beyond performative actions.
Malvika explains why the rise of AI is actually elevating the importance of human interaction in the workplace. As technical skills become more commoditized through low-code solutions, what she calls power skills – the ability to connect, empathize, and collaborate – are becoming the true differentiators. For HR professionals especially, this technological shift creates an unprecedented opportunity to focus on the truly human aspects of human resources.
Malvika Jethmalani is a 3x CHRO and the Co-Founder of Atvis Group – a human capital advisory firm driven by the core belief that to win in the marketplace, businesses must first win in the workplace.
